Output 265d863a8fe68f53dcbb7614df72cf559f88bd38ab4e2b784ed20e39c8b94ab2:0

value
27000000
script pubkey
OP_0 OP_PUSHBYTES_20 ba57b6bdd5894ce26828b4e362ab94ab8ade9798
address
ltc1qhftmd0w439xwy6pgkn3k92u54w9da9ucpqzfz3
transaction
265d863a8fe68f53dcbb7614df72cf559f88bd38ab4e2b784ed20e39c8b94ab2
spent
true